How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Albert Park - Emerson Park?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Albert Park - Emerson Park Studio Apartments | $1,254 | $652 | $1,650 |
Albert Park - Emerson Park 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,808 | $1,018 | $3,677 |
Albert Park - Emerson Park 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,423 | $1,307 | $5,345 |
Albert Park - Emerson Park 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,962 | $1,585 | $3,647 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Utilities Included Albert Park - Emerson Park Apartments
What is the Cheapest Utilities Included apartment in Albert Park - Emerson Park?
Currently the most affordable Utilities Included Apartment in Albert Park - Emerson Park is at Annapolis Apartments listed at $945.
How much is the average rent for a Utilities Included Albert Park - Emerson Park Apartment?
The average rent for a Utilities Included Apartment in Albert Park - Emerson Park is $1,360.
What is the largest Utilities Included Albert Park - Emerson Park Apartment for rent?
Today's Utilities Included apartment with the most square footage in Albert Park - Emerson Park is a 1,542 square feet unit starting from $1,275 at The Scenic.
What is the average size for Albert Park - Emerson Park Utilities Included Apartments for rent?
The average size for a Utilities Included rental in Albert Park - Emerson Park is currently at 640 sq ft.
